Is Minneapolis, MN safe?
Minneapolis, MN earns a NeighborScope crime grade of B, with a combined violent + property crime rate of 2,270 per 100k residents — in line with similarly sized US cities. By this measure, Minneapolis is safer than average. NeighborScope grades crime from the FBI Crime Data Explorer using a city-wide aggregate; for street-level patterns and recent incidents, use the NeighborScope app.
What is the crime rate in Minneapolis, MN?
Per the FBI Crime Data Explorer, Minneapolis reports a violent crime rate of 247 per 100,000 residents and a property crime rate of 2,023 per 100,000. These are city-wide aggregates and reflect crime reported to law enforcement, not all crime that occurs.
